Jimmie Johnson's Anything with an Engine will allow players to race in vehicles created from the most unlikely of everyday objects - from dumpsters to lawnmowers - fulfilling Jimmie's "Anything with an engine!" motto. Lead-footed drivers will engage in elimination-style circuits across progressively challenging tracks, complete with pyrotechnics-laden theatrical sets strewn with wicked hazards, traps and jumps.
Problems
Mirrored Screen
Most objects in the game are mirrored (except for the background of the pause screen and a few transitions.) This is an up/down mirror, making everything appear upside down. Fixed by 5.0-3021 which implemented negative viewport dimensions.
Missing Objects
Many of the stage objects are completely missing, including the track. Fixed by 5.0-3021 which implemented negative viewport dimensions.
